CP Aina Adesola has assumed duty as the 23rd Commissioner of Police in Delta State, replacing Assistant Inspector General of Police Olufemi Abaniwonda, who has been transferred to the Force Headquarters in Abuja following his recent promotion.

The development was contained in a press release issued on Sunday by the Police Public Relations Officer of the Delta State Command, SP Bright Edafe, and made available to journalists in Asaba.

Adesola was born on September 2, 1968, and hails from Abeokuta South Local Government Area of Ogun State. He holds a Bachelor of Science degree in Sociology from Ondo State University and was enlisted into the Nigeria Police Force as a Cadet Assistant Superintendent of Police on June 10, 1994, after training at the Nigeria Police Academy, Wudil, Kano State.

He first served in Delta State in 1996 at Ogwashi Uku and has since built a career spanning operational, administrative, investigative, and training roles across several commands.

His past postings include Divisional Police Officer at Aswani Division, Officer in Charge of Homicide at Edo State Command, Officer in Charge of X Squad Zone 2 Lagos, Assistant Commissioner of Police in charge of Finance and Administration in Abia State, and Commandant of the Police Training School, Oyin Akoko, Ondo State.

Adesola also served at the Force Headquarters as Deputy Commissioner of Police in the Department of Operations, as well as Deputy Commissioner of Police in charge of Operations and the State Criminal Investigation Department in Delta and Rivers states respectively.

Before his deployment back to Delta State in January 2026, he served as Deputy Commandant of the Police College, Ikeja, Lagos State.

In addition to his field experience, the new Commissioner of Police has attended several leadership and specialised courses within and outside Nigeria, including international law enforcement programmes in Botswana and the United States.

While taking over the leadership of the Command, Adesola pledged to strengthen existing security frameworks and promote proactive and community focused policing across the state.

He appealed to residents to continue to cooperate with security agencies and advised youths to stay away from crime.

In his handing over remarks, AIG Abaniwonda thanked the Delta State Government and residents for their support during his tenure and urged them to extend the same cooperation to his successor.

Adesola assured residents that under his leadership, the Delta State Police Command would remain professional and firm in ensuring that criminal activities are effectively curtailed across the state.
